In recent years, no significant WebYou're granted 10,000 shares of restricted stock on January 1, 2013. At that time, the stock is worth $20 per share. Five years later, when the stock vests, it's worth $30 per share. If you take the 83 (b) election, you lock in the income tax and long-term capital gains tax rate that's in effect when you make the election.
